Output e3bed64ac27fe0d7a40e0a9b9c740338d2271498769751d4e0180f5f60b9c4d6:21

value
14364
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3889dd7b84eee01a6a78cc7181173dadcdc9404b8cfee041465db6790254e240
address
bc1p8zya67uyamsp56nce3ccz9ea4hxujszt3nlwqs2xtkm8jqj5ufqqjtwvsn
transaction
e3bed64ac27fe0d7a40e0a9b9c740338d2271498769751d4e0180f5f60b9c4d6